Output f431ca89074690e97f79b3eefac1e4b426b51540ff8c59073af56ec833cea81a:0

value
3159500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81ffab57941b6613da9e23ebddfb61a064ac156d OP_EQUAL
address
3DYPNWDojVdFgr93e7XEVnm4UXEGdi1fwv
transaction
f431ca89074690e97f79b3eefac1e4b426b51540ff8c59073af56ec833cea81a
spent
true